What volume (in liters) does 3.91
moles of nitrogen gas at 5.35 atm
and 323 K occupy

Data Given:
Moles = n = 3.91 mol

Pressure = P = 5.35 atm

Temperature = T = 323 K

Volume = V = ?

Formula used: Ideal Gas Equation is used,

P V = n R T
Solving for V,
V = n R T / P
Putting Values,
V = (3.91 mol × 0.0825 atm.L.mol⁻¹.K⁻¹ × 323 K) ÷ 5.35 atm

V = 19.36 L
